查詢埠被占用的方法 windows

2021-08-15 15:41:56 字數 744 閱讀 6045

使用情景:有時候我們會出現需要的埠號被占用,而不知道具體是哪個程式占用的。這時我們需要找到使用此埠的程式。

解決辦法:

首先,以管理員身份開啟命令提示符視窗(開始-執行)。

然後,使用命令檢視埠使用情況,這裡以埠6000為例。命令:netstat -aon | findstr 「6000」。

從圖中可以看到,有乙個程式占用了這個6000埠,最後一列是pid(程序id)。也就是說這個pid為7140的程序占用了6000埠。

然後,我們利用找到的pid值,查詢出這個pid為7140的程序具體是什麼程式。輸入命令:tasklist | findstr 「7140」

可以看到是testsocket.exe這個程式占用了。

如果不想此程式繼續占用埠號,那麼就關閉此程式,輸入命令:taskkill /pid 7140 /f

這樣,程式就被終止,埠號就被空置出來。

查詢被占用的埠

3.ctrl alt del開啟任務管理器,選程序,這裡有很多正在執行的程式怎麼找?別急點上面的 檢視 選擇列 在pid 程序標示符 前面打鉤。好了,下面的程序前面都有了pid號碼。這時上 一步找到的pid就有用了,找到1484,比如peer.exe什麼的,結束程序吧。這時再開伺服器,看 web可以...

埠被占用?

埠被占用 一般情況下的埠占用解決方案 按鍵盤win r 開啟執行介面,輸入cmd,確定,開啟管理員介面 輸入netstat aon findstr 8080 輸入tasklist findstr 1564 然後再計算機的服務裡停止對應的服務,解除占用。80埠被占用的解決方案 一般情況下,使用一般情況...

Windows查詢查殺被占用埠

windows常用命令用法 netstat aon findstr 埠號 tasklist findstr 2720 終止pid程序 taskkill pid 4276 強制終止pid程序 taskkill f pid 4276 kill f 程序名 加 f引數後強制結束某程序 calc 啟動計算器...